Probate Estate Administration
When someone close to you dies, you may find yourself as the person designated to make critical decisions regarding their estate. Probate is the legal process of paying the debts and distributing the property of someone who has died pursuant to their wishes and in accordance with Minnesota law.

Every probate is unique, but will most likely involve the following steps:

  • Filing a petition with the proper probate court
  • Giving proper notice to heirs and interested parties
  • Getting a personal representative appointed
  • Preparing an inventory of the estate assets
  • Prioritizing payment of the estate debts and taxes
  • Preparing an accounting of the estate administration
  • Preparing tax returns; and
  • Distributing assets to the applicable heirs.
